Ground Turkey Black Bean Enchiladas are a delicious and healthy twist on a classic Mexican dish. Made with lean ground turkey, fiber-rich black beans, and tangy enchilada sauce, these enchiladas are perfect for a quick and satisfying weeknight meal.
Ingredients

- 1 Tbsp olive oil
- 1 yellow onion, diced (1 small or 1/2 large)
- 3 cloves garlic, minced
- 1 jalapeño, seeded and diced
- Salt and pepper, to taste
- 1 lb ground turkey
- 3 Tbsp enchilada seasoning
- 1 (15 oz) can black beans, drained and rinsed
- 1 (14.5 oz) can diced tomatoes
- 1 (28 oz) can red enchilada sauce
- 1–2 cups shredded cheddar cheese
- 8–10 8-inch flour tortillas
Instructions
- Preheat the oven to 400°F (200°C).
- In a large sauté pan, heat olive oil over medium heat. Add the diced onion, garlic, and jalapeño, and cook for 5 minutes until softened.
- Add the ground turkey to the pan and cook until no longer pink. Stir in the enchilada seasoning, diced tomatoes, and black beans. Cook for a couple of minutes to combine the flavors.
- Pour 1 cup of enchilada sauce into a 9×13-inch baking dish.
- Scoop the turkey and bean mixture into the tortillas (about ½ cup per tortilla) and roll them up. Place them seam-side down in the prepared baking dish.
- Pour the remaining enchilada sauce over the top and sprinkle with shredded cheddar cheese.
- Bake for 20-25 minutes, or until the cheese is melted and bubbly. Let cool slightly before serving.
- Top with your favorite garnishes like sour cream, avocado, and cilantro.
